Steps to Take in an Emergency
When dealing with a window emergency, follow these steps to make sure a safe and quick resolution:
Assess the Damage: Determine how serious the damage is. If glass is broken, clear the location of any sharp pieces to prevent injury.
Protect the Area: Use plywood or cardboard to cover large openings temporarily. This action helps stay out intruders and safeguards against weather condition.
Contact Professionals: Reach out to emergency window repair services. Look for companies with 24/7 availability to guarantee a rapid reaction time.
File the Damage: Take photos of the damage for insurance coverage purposes. This paperwork can assist improve the claims process.
Follow Up: After the emergency repair, think about scheduling a more long-term solution, such as a complete window replacement or more substantial repairs.
Types of Emergency Window Repairs
Depending upon the nature and degree of the damage, several kinds of repairs may be performed:
1. Glass Replacement
This involves replacing shattered or broken glass panes while keeping the window frame undamaged. Various kinds of glass can be utilized, including tempered or laminated glass, depending on the requirements.
2. Board-Up Services
For severely harmed windows, professional services might board up the window to offer instant security and protection from the aspects.
3. Frame Repair
Sometimes, the window frame itself might be harmed. In such cases, repairs may include replacing or strengthening wood or metal framing.
4. Lock Replacement
If the window lock is broken, it needs to be changed to ensure security. A locksmith can rapidly handle this repair.
5. Seal Replacement
If there are drafts, it might suggest a broken seal. A professional can change weather removing or caulking to improve energy effectiveness.
Expense of Emergency Window Repair
The cost of emergency window repair can vary considerably based on a number of aspects, including the degree of the damage, the type of window, and labor expenses in your location. Below is a basic breakdown of possible costs:
| Type of Repair | Approximated Cost |
|---|---|
| Glass Replacement | ₤ 200 - ₤ 600 |
| Board-Up Services |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 |
| Frame Repair | ₤ 150 - ₤ 500 |
| Lock Replacement |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
| Seal Replacement | ₤ 75 - ₤ 250 |
Keep in mind: Prices may vary based upon location and the specific scenarios of the repair.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How can I prevent window damage in the future?
A1: Regular maintenance, consisting of cleaning and inspecting seals, can assist prevent damage. In addition, consider storm windows or impact-resistant glass in locations vulnerable to serious weather condition.
Q2: What should I do if my window is broken after business hours?
A2: Contact a window repair service that provides 24/7 emergency help. Many credible companies have emergency protocols to deal with such scenarios.
Q3: Can I repair my window myself?
A3: Minor repairs, like replacing weather removing, can sometimes be done personally. However, for substantial damage, professional assistance is suggested for security and effectiveness.
Q4: Will my insurance cover the expense of window repair?
A4: Most property owner's insurance coverage policies cover window damage, however it's necessary to talk to your supplier. Documenting the damage can support your claim.
Q5: How long does window repair typically take?
A5: The time it requires to finish a window repair differs depending on the damage. Minor repairs can be carried out in a couple of hours, while substantial damage may need a few days.
